Autor Thema: TrillSpan in zitierten Noten  (Gelesen 1789 mal)

spinne

  • Member
TrillSpan in zitierten Noten
« am: Donnerstag, 6. September 2012, 14:07 »
Hallo,

Ich erstellen einen kompletten Orchestersatz. Zitierte Stimmen werden mit \cueDuring hinzugefügt. Hab verschiedene quotedEventTypes gesetzt damit auch die Artikulation, Bögen usw zitiert werden:

\set Score.quotedEventTypes = #'(note-event articulation-event
                                     crescendo-event rest-event
                                     slur-event dynamic-event tie-event beam-event tuplet-span-event)

Triller (\startTrillSpan und \stopTrillSpan) werden leider nicht zitiert. Gibt es eine Möglichkeit dies zu ändern?

Danke und Gruss
Holger

Be-3

  • Member
Re: TrillSpan in zitierten Noten
« Antwort #1 am: Donnerstag, 6. September 2012, 14:50 »
Hallo Holger,

ein heißer Kandidat ;) wäre z. B. trill-span-event. Wenn Du allerdings prinzipiell alles anzeigen lassen willst, kannst Du einfach
\set Score.quotedCueEventTypes = #'(music-event) 
setzen, dann kommt alles mit.

Übrigens: für \cueDuring ist quotedCueEventTypes zuständig, nicht \cueDuring ist quotedEventTypes!
Bitte auch möglichst ein compilierbares Beispiel mitschicken, das macht allen das Leben einfacher.

Viele Grüße
Torsten

spinne

  • Member
Re: TrillSpan in zitierten Noten
« Antwort #2 am: Donnerstag, 6. September 2012, 15:29 »
Danke:-)

Allerdings:
GNU LilyPond 2.12.3
Warnung: Eigenschafts-Typprüfung für »quotedCueEventTypes« (translation-type?) kann nicht gefunden werden.  vielleicht ein Tippfehler?

Wenn ich aber:
\set Score.quotedEventTypes = #'(music-event)

Und danach:
\cueDuring #"Oboe" #UP { r4^\markup { \smaller "Oboe" } | R1*4 }

dann funktioniert alles so wie es soll:-) Warum? (Nur interesse halber, hauptsache es tut was es soll:-) )

Danke
gruss
Holger

Be-3

  • Member
Re: TrillSpan in zitierten Noten
« Antwort #3 am: Donnerstag, 6. September 2012, 19:08 »
Hallo Holger,

das zeigt wieder einmal, wie wichtig es ist,
  • die benutzte Version und
  • einen compilierbaren Beispielcode
anzugeben.

Die von Dir genannte Warnung kommt bei mir nicht (eine ältere Version als 2.14.2 habe ich nicht mehr installiert). Immerhin kann man aus der Warnung lesen, daß Du noch v2.12.3 hast.

Das von Dir benutzte quotedEventTypes ist mittlerweile um ein separates quotedCueEventTypes erweitert worden und hat deshalb bei mir (v2.14.2, bis v2.17.1) überhaupt keine Auswirkungen mehr auf \cueDuring.

Viele Grüße
Torsten

spinne

  • Member
Re: TrillSpan in zitierten Noten
« Antwort #4 am: Freitag, 7. September 2012, 00:27 »
Hallo,

danke für die Info. Darum hab ich die Version mit hingeschrieben. Kompilierbares Beispiel ist bisschen Umfangreich:-) Ist ein ziemlich grosses Projekt mit vielen Dateien. Da es jetzt das tut was es soll ist gut. Aber dank Deiner Hilfe weiss ich dass ich vielleicht mal ein Update machen sollte bzw nachschauen welche Version aktuell in meinem Gentoo ist:-)

Gruss

Holger